BitMine has announced the accumulation of 1,174,000 ETH, equivalent to $5.26 billion. This development occurred against the backdrop of institutional funding, underscoring growing interest in Ethereum.
BitMine's ETH Holdings
BitMine now owns 1,174,000 ETH, which is valued at approximately $5.26 billion as of now. This represents a significant increase in Ethereum reserves following a recent $250 million funding round, highlighting a trend towards institutional adoption of Ethereum as a reserve asset.
Price Movements in the Ethereum Market
As of the announcement, Ethereum is trading at $4,423.21 with a 3.09% decrease over the past 24 hours. The market capitalization of ETH stands at $533.92 billion. Despite recent fluctuations, ETH has seen a 78.67% increase over the past 90 days, indicating high investor interest.
